But you'll walk into every contractor conversation already knowing your ballpark. What a Roof Replacement Costs A typical roof replacement for an average U.S. home runs between $9,000 and $22,000. Here's a quick breakdown by material: Architectural shingles generally run $4.50 to $6.50 per square foot on average, which translates to $9,000 to $13,000 for most homes. Metal roofing runs $10 to $14 per square foot, averaging $20,000 to $28,000. Synthetic roofing falls between $8 and $16 per square foot. Roof coatings are the most budget-friendly option at $3 to $3.75 per square foot. Location matters too. West Coast homeowners typically pay 25 to 35 percent above the national average. The Northeast runs 15 to 30 percent higher. The Southeast sits close to the national baseline, while the Midwest often comes in about 5 percent below average.
